Ozone generator
Abstract
The present invention relates to methods and forms of apparatus for sterilizing various objects with ozone. The contents of a container may be sterilized by attaching a lid with an ozone generator to the container and generating ozone. Clothing may be treated by attaching the clothing to an ozone generator with a housing in the shape of a clothes hanger and generating ozone. Alternatively, the ozone generator in the shape of a clothes hanger may be placed in a closet with clothing to be treated. The power supply for the ozone generator may be a portable power supply, or power may be supplied from an adapter from an electrical outlet. Shoes may be deodorized by placing an ozone generator with an oblong shape in the shoes and generating ozone. A medical device may be sterilized by attaching the medical device to a sterilizing tip attached to a tubular screen, where the tubular screen is attached to the tip at one end and to an ozone generator at the other end, energizing the ozone generator and passing an oxygen-containing gas through the ozone generator to generate ozone.
